What is the meaning of 'might have gone'?
Back
It indicates a possibility that someone went somewhere, but it is not certain.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does 'must have seen' imply?
Back
It suggests a strong belief or certainty that someone has seen something.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
True or False: 'Mustn't' and 'can't' can be used interchangeably.
Back
False. 'Mustn't' indicates prohibition, while 'can't' indicates impossibility.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does 'might have not gone' suggest about someone's attendance?
Back
It indicates a possibility that the person did not attend.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the difference between 'could have' and 'might have'?
Back
'Could have' suggests a possibility, while 'might have' suggests a weaker possibility.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Define 'can't have gone'.
Back
It indicates that it is impossible for someone to have gone somewhere.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does 'must have made' imply about an action?
Back
It suggests a strong belief that an action was completed.
